Overview
SBR1U150SAQ-13 from Diodes Incorporated is a 1.0A surface-mount Super Barrier Rectifier (SBR®) with 150V peak repetitive reverse voltage, 0.70V max forward voltage at 1.0A/25°C, and 0.1mA max leakage at 150V/25°C, designed for polarity protection and recirculating diode functions in automotive-grade DC-DC converters.

Technical Context
This SBR device uses patented Super Barrier Rectifier technology to achieve lower forward voltage than Schottky diodes while maintaining higher reverse voltage capability and superior high-temperature stability. Its soft recovery characteristic (9ns tRR) minimizes EMI in switching power supplies.
The device is rated for 1.0A average forward current with derating above +25°C ambient, supports 42A non-repetitive surge current, and delivers 6,000W peak avalanche power at 1µs pulse width - enabling robust operation in transient-prone automotive and industrial power rails.

FAQ
What is the difference between SBR1U150SAQ-13 and SBR1U150SA-13?
SBR1U150SAQ-13 is the AEC-Q qualified automotive version with full test documentation per JEDEC standards referenced in AEC-Q; SBR1U150SA-13 is the commercial-grade variant lacking automotive qualification records and traceability. Both share identical electrical specs and SMA packaging, but only the "Q" suffix meets automotive PPAP requirements.
Can SBR1U150SAQ-13 be used as a direct replacement for a standard 1N4007 in a 12V AC-DC bridge?
No - SBR1U150SAQ-13 is a single anode-cathode device rated for 1.0A average current and 150V reverse voltage, whereas 1N4007 is a 1A/1000V PN rectifier with different thermal and surge characteristics. It cannot substitute in full-wave bridge configurations without redesigning layout, thermal path, and surge protection.
What is the maximum allowable PCB pad temperature during reflow soldering?
The SMA package supports lead-free reflow per J-STD-020 Level 1 moisture sensitivity. Peak reflow temperature must not exceed 260°C for ≤10 seconds, with ramp rates ≤3°C/s pre-peak. Exceeding these limits risks delamination or internal wire bond failure due to thermal stress on the molded plastic body.
Does SBR1U150SAQ-13 require a heatsink in a 1.0A continuous application at +85°C ambient?
No - with RθJA = 88°C/W on polyimide PCB (Note 7) and 0.56V VF at +125°C junction, power dissipation is ~0.56W, resulting in ~49°C rise above ambient. At +85°C ambient, junction temperature reaches ~134°C - within the +150°C limit, so no external heatsink is required with proper copper pour and via stitching.
